Abstract:The isostructural metal-insulator transition in Cr-doped V 2 O 3 is the textbook example of a Mott-Hubbard transition between a paramagnetic metal and a paramagnetic insulator. We review recent theoretical calculations as well as experimental findings which shed new light on this famous transition. In particular, the old paradigm of a dopingpressure equivalence does not hold, and there is a microscale phase separation for Cr-doped V 2 O 3 .
